UNPKG

1.16 kBJSONView Raw
1{
2 "name": "defu",
3 "version": "6.1.4",
4 "description": "Recursively assign default properties. Lightweight and Fast!",
5 "repository": "unjs/defu",
6 "license": "MIT",
7 "exports": {
8 ".": {
9 "types": "./dist/defu.d.ts",
10 "import": "./dist/defu.mjs",
11 "require": "./lib/defu.cjs"
12 }
13 },
14 "main": "./lib/defu.cjs",
15 "module": "./dist/defu.mjs",
16 "types": "./dist/defu.d.ts",
17 "files": [
18 "dist",
19 "lib"
20 ],
21 "devDependencies": {
22 "@types/node": "^20.10.6",
23 "@vitest/coverage-v8": "^1.1.3",
24 "changelogen": "^0.5.5",
25 "eslint": "^8.56.0",
26 "eslint-config-unjs": "^0.2.1",
27 "expect-type": "^0.17.3",
28 "prettier": "^3.1.1",
29 "typescript": "^5.3.3",
30 "unbuild": "^2.0.0",
31 "vitest": "^1.1.3"
32 },
33 "packageManager": "pnpm@8.10.2",
34 "scripts": {
35 "build": "unbuild",
36 "dev": "vitest",
37 "lint": "eslint --ext .ts src && prettier -c src test",
38 "lint:fix": "eslint --ext .ts src --fix && prettier -w src test",
39 "release": "pnpm test && changelogen --release && git push --follow-tags && pnpm publish",
40 "test": "pnpm lint && pnpm vitest run",
41 "test:types": "tsc --noEmit"
42 }
43}
\No newline at end of file